Common Name | Malvidin 3-O-[6-O-[4-O-[4-O-(6-O-caffeoyl-beta-D-glucopyranosyl)-p-coumaroyl]-alpha-L-rhamnosyl]-beta-D-glucopyranoside]-5-O-beta-D-glucopyranoside |
---|
Description | 3-{[(2S,3R,4R,5S,6R)-6-({[(2R,3S,4S,5R,6S)-5-{[(2E)-3-(4-{[(2S,3R,4S,5S,6R)-6-({[3-(3,4-dihydroxyphenyl)prop-2-enoyl]oxy}methyl)-3,4,5-trihydroxyoxan-2-yl]oxy}phenyl)prop-2-enoyl]oxy}-3,4-dihydroxy-6-methyloxan-2-yl]oxy}methyl)-3,4,5-trihydroxyoxan-2-yl]oxy}-7-hydroxy-2-(4-hydroxy-3,5-dimethoxyphenyl)-5-{[(2S,3S,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xy}-1λ⁴-chromen-1-ylium belongs to the class of organic compounds known as anthocyanidin-5-o-glycosides. These are phenolic compounds containing one anthocyanidin moiety which is O-glycosidically linked to a carbohydrate moiety at the C5-position. Malvidin 3-O-[6-O-[4-O-[4-O-(6-O-caffeoyl-beta-D-glucopyranosyl)-p-coumaroyl]-alpha-L-rhamnosyl]-beta-D-glucopyranoside]-5-O-beta-D-glucopyranoside is found in Petunia guarapuavensis, Petunia hybrid cultivar and Petunia hybrida cultivar.
